Likewise, when heating a test tube over a flame always hold the test tube? 1 Answer. Hold the test tube at an angle. Point the test tube away from yourself and all other people. Heat the test tube gently from the top of the substance being heated, and always wear safety googles.

Beaker - A beaker is a glass container with a flat bottom and a small spout for pouring. It is used in the chemistry lab for mixing, heating, and stirring liquids. Beakers come in various sizes and are shaped like a cylinder. Crucible - Crucibles are containers used for heating substances to very high temperatures.

A beaker is generally a cylindrical container with a flat bottom. Most also have a small spout (or "beak") to aid pouring, as shown in the picture. The exception to this definition is a slightly conical-sided beaker called a Philips beaker.What does the clay triangle sit on?

Flasks are useful types of chemistry glassware for containing liquid and performing mixing, heating, cooling, precipitation, condensation, and other processes. Noun. ring stand (plural ring stands) (chemistry) An item of laboratory equipment consisting of a metal pole with a solid, firm base, used to hold or clamp laboratory glassware and other equipment in place, so that it does not fall down or come apart.What are the laboratory tools used as accessories for heating?
A common requirement in a laboratory experiment is the need to heat a sample. Several pieces of equipment can do this, including the Bunsen burner, laboratory oven, hot plate and incubator.What is a beaker?
